What Is the World Cup Headband Worn By the U.S. Players?

Alex Morgan can simply rattle off the colours of the headbands worn by her United States teammates.

She wears pink, as does Rose Lavelle. Sophia Smith likes black. Julie Ertz prefers a shade nearer to Tiffany blue. Lindsey Horan wears crimson, largely as a result of Morgan doesn’t.

“One of the first times I wore pink, someone said I’m trying to copy Alex Morgan,” Horan stated.

Morgan laughed. “I never knew that,” she stated.

Soccer’s favourite headband, although, isn’t a scarf in any respect. The sheer coloured strips preserving a number of the world’s finest athletes’ hair in place is definitely what is called pre-wrap — a skinny, stretchy medical gauze supposed to be wrapped round injured knees or ankles earlier than they’re taped, partly to guard the pores and skin.

And whereas each women and men way back co-opted the athletic dressing for a extra outstanding objective of their hair, Morgan and different ladies’s soccer gamers have turned pre-wrap into an emblem of ladies’s sports activities — and soccer particularly — to accent their crew kits and specific individuality on the sector.

“There is a kind of unique, almost strategic use of pre-wrap in women’s soccer,” stated Rachel Allison, a sociology professor at Mississippi State who has studied how the game has marketed itself. “Obviously, wearing the headband can be functional in terms of holding your hair back while you’re playing the sport, but I think it’s become far more than that.”

Morgan, for instance, started carrying pink pre-wrap in order that her dad and mom may choose her out in a sea of ponytails on the soccer discipline, and later selected the colour to honor her mother-in-law, who’s a breast most cancers survivor. Morgan is now even sponsored by one of many major producers of pre-wrap, Mueller Sports activities Medication.

“These are forms of individual self expression, but they’re also really important to how we’re marketing women’s sport,” Allison stated. “They become part of the storytelling that we do around who these women are, not only as players, but also people in ways that help to connect to the audience.”

The pre-wrap options prominently within the branding of the gamers, together with how they’re portrayed in varied merchandise. Earlier than the match, goalkeeper Alyssa Naeher shared an image of a figurine clipped to her bag that depicted Becky Sauerbrunn, the defender and former captain of the U.S. crew who’s out of the World Cup with a foot damage, full with a pink strip throughout her brow.

Brett Mueller, the chief govt of Mueller Sports activities Medication, stated the corporate initially started producing pre-wrap within the Nineteen Seventies to be used within the N.F.L. and N.B.A., however it turned in style as a hair accent for ladies and women after referees stated they couldn’t put on arduous plastic barrettes or clips due to damage dangers. Shortly, he stated, his firm needed to develop its shade choices from the unique tan, first to in style faculty colours after which to a brighter, wider vary — together with pink.

“It’s exciting that these athletes — and our team is so good, too — are using our product,” Mueller stated, including: “But we didn’t design it for that.”

Allison stated that when she performed faculty soccer at Grinnell Faculty in Iowa, the place she graduated in 2007, a few her teammates wore the gauzy headbands. Many extra folks do now, she stated.

“It’s not uncommon to see other people, especially girls or young women, wearing pre-wrap when they’re in the stands watching,” Allison stated. “It’s a way for them to symbolize their fandom.”

There are two camps of pre-wrap headbands: those that roll it into skinny, tubular strands that arise barely on their heads, like Morgan and Horan, and people who unfold it flat on prime of their hair, like Smith and Ertz. The strategy issues — midfielder Rose Lavelle wears pink pre-wrap, however as a member of Workforce Flat, she’s protected from comparisons to Morgan.

And whereas it’s most blatant within the gamers’ hair, Morgan stated the crew additionally makes use of pre-wrap for its initially supposed objective: beneath their shin guards and likewise to tape up ankles.

“Pre-wrap is everywhere,” Morgan stated. “You look in the bins, and it’s endless pre-wrap.”
